Latest Patents
Shamsoddini holds a patent for a "Personal sound system including multi-mode ear level module with priority logic." This personal sound system features a wireless network that supports an ear-level module, a companion module, and a phone. The system is designed to accommodate various audio sources and includes a configuration processor that configures the ear-level module and companion module for private communications. Additionally, it offers a plurality of signal processing modes, including a hearing aid mode, tailored for different audio data sources. The ear module is adept at managing various audio sources and controlling the switching among them.
